草庐IT

Java TCP 连接

全部标签

java - RabbitMQ 连接处于阻塞状态?

我连接到RabbitMQ服务器时我的连接显示为阻塞状态,我无法发布新消息我有6GB的可用内存和磁盘空间也约为8GB如何在RabbitMQ中配置磁盘空间限制 最佳答案 我遇到了同样的问题。似乎rabbitmq服务器使用的内存超过阈值http://www.rabbitmq.com/memory.html我运行了以下命令来解锁这些连接:rabbitmqctlset_vm_memory_high_watermark0.6(默认值为0.4) 关于java-RabbitMQ连接处于阻塞状态?,我们在

java - 连接与数据源

我正在阅读有关Java中的Connection与DataSource的内容,我有一些问题。DataSource真的只是一个管理器和Connection(或多个连接)的抽象吗? 最佳答案 来自docs:AfactoryforconnectionstothephysicaldatasourcethatthisDataSourceobjectrepresents.AnalternativetotheDriverManagerfacility,aDataSourceobjectisthepreferredmeansofgettingacon

arkTS开发鸿蒙OS应用(登录页面实现,连接数据库)

前言喜欢的朋友可在抖音、小红书、微信公众号、哔哩哔哩搜索“淼学派对”。知乎搜索“编程淼”。前端架构Toubu.etsimportrouterfrom'@ohos.router'@ComponentexportstructHeader{build(){//标题部分Row({space:5}){Image($r('app.media.fanhui')).width(20).onClick(()=>{router.back()})Blank()Image($r('app.media.shuaxin')).width(30)}.width('98%').height(30)}}Index.etsimp

【雕爷学编程】Arduino智慧校园之使用ESP32连接WiFi并上传温度数据到服务器

Arduino是一个开放源码的电子原型平台,它可以让你用简单的硬件和软件来创建各种互动的项目。Arduino的核心是一个微控制器板,它可以通过一系列的引脚来连接各种传感器、执行器、显示器等外部设备。Arduino的编程是基于C/C++语言的,你可以使用ArduinoIDE(集成开发环境)来编写、编译和上传代码到Arduino板上。Arduino还有一个丰富的库和社区,你可以利用它们来扩展Arduino的功能和学习Arduino的知识。Arduino的特点是:1、开放源码:Arduino的硬件和软件都是开放源码的,你可以自由地修改、复制和分享它们。2、易用:Arduino的硬件和软件都是为初学者

java - 按键连接两个 map

我有两张map:MapmapOne={(1,"a"),(2,"b")};MapmapTwo={(1,10.0),(2,20.0)};并且我想通过Integer值将这些映射组合成一个,所以结果映射是MapmapResult={("a",10.0),("b",20.0)};有没有比遍历条目集更容易做到这一点的方法? 最佳答案 假设两个映射的键匹配并且映射具有相同数量的条目,对于Java8,您可以将其写在一行中:Mapmap=mapOne.entrySet().stream().collect(toMap(e->e.getValue(),

java - spring-boot 中 tomcat 的默认连接池?

使用spring-boot的postgres数据库和tomcat连接池的最大连接数的默认值是多少?有一个属性spring.datasource.maxActive,但是当我尝试对它进行系统输出时,出现异常:@Value("${spring.datasource.maxActive}")privateStringact;java.lang.IllegalArgumentException:无法解析字符串值“${spring.datasource.maxActive}”中的占位符“spring.datasource.maxActive” 最佳答案

java - JMeter 是否池化 HTTP 连接?

我知道在JMeter中使用内置的JavaHTTP客户端时HTTP请求采样器连接可能会也可能不会被合并,具体取决于JVM实现和配置。但是,当使用HttpClient3.1或HttpClient4时,JMeter会池化连接吗?JMeter文档中有一些提示,但文档中没有明确说明。如果是这样,有没有办法控制连接池?例如,您可以设置池的大小吗? 最佳答案 当使用HttpClient3.1或HttpClient4时,JMeter会做一些HTTP连接池。在这两种情况下,连接都是按线程合并的。连接不跨线程共享。当使用HttpClient3.1时,J

java - 尝试连接到 Web 套接字服务器时不断收到 No X509TrustManager implementation available 错误

我有以下代码使用安全的websockets在我的java应用程序中连接到web套接字服务器。privatebooleanopenConnection(booleantried){StringsslFile=ConfigMgr.getValue(Constants.SSL_CFG_NAME,"sslfile");StringsslPassword=ConfigMgr.getValue(Constants.SSL_CFG_NAME,"sslpassword");try{System.setProperty("javax.net.ssl.trustStore",//sslFile);Syst

java - 从 Java 应用程序连接 LDAP 服务器

我正在构建一个基于GXT(J2EE)的应用程序。现在的问题是我必须将应用程序连接到LDAP服务器。你能告诉我如何从我们的Java应用程序连接LDAP服务器,以及为此我必须使用什么库或API吗? 最佳答案 要连接到LDAP,请检查以下包/类:javax.naming.directory.*javax.naming.ladp.*com.sun.jndi.ldap.LdapCtxFactorycom.sun.jndi.ldap.ControlFactory示例代码://buildahashtablecontainingallthenece

java - Netty:如果是 'keep-alive' 连接,我应该关闭 Channel 吗?

我正在用Netty编写一个HTTP服务器。我在创建服务器引导时设置了keep-alive选项。bootstrap.setOption("child.keepAlive",true);每次我写一个HTTP响应时,我都会设置keep-aliveheader并在写完响应后关闭channel。rep.setHeader("Connection","keep-alive");channel.write(rep).addListener(ChannelFutureListener.CLOSE);我不确定是否应该关闭channel。 最佳答案 假